Kinnibrugh, 66, died November 8 at Artesia General Hospital. She was born June 16, 1933, in Ringland, Okla., to Horace Greely Buchanan and Norma Ruby Morgan Buchanan. She married Orthell Kinnibrugh on March 11, 1950, in Carlsbad, NM. She was a baptist. Survivors include her husband of the family home; sons Randy Kinnibrugh, Arvin Kinnibrugh and Tracy Kinnibrugh, all of Artesia; daughters Debra Sallee and Becky Crockett, both of Artesia; brothers Bruce Buchanan of Hobbs, NM and Richard Buchanan of Denver, Colo.; 12 grandchildren, and eight great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her parents; son, Ernie Ray Kinnibrugh; sister, Betty Jane Buchanan; and brothers, H.G. Buchanan, Cameron Oliver Buchanan and Jackie Doyle Buchanan.
